  • In this book, which is conceived as an expression of critical geopolitics, reconstruction is identified as a process of conflict and of militarized power, not something that clearly demarcates a post-war period of peace. Challenging the familiar
  • dichotomy between war and peace, 15 chapters explore ways that war and peace are mutually constituted in the creation of historically specific geographies and geographical knowledges. Case studies are drawn from experiences in Afghanistan, Cyprus, France
